What Is Elder Law?

Elder law focuses on legal issues affecting older adults. It covers various topics, including estate planning, wills, trusts, guardianship, Medicaid and Medicare access, and nursing home care. This area of law addresses the unique needs and challenges that the elderly and their families face. Elder law aims to protect the rights and interests of seniors, ensuring they receive proper care, manage their assets effectively, and make informed decisions about their future.

What Are Some Examples of Situations Where I Might Need an Elder Law Lawyer?

You might need an elder law lawyer if you or a loved one are:

  • Planning your estate, creating a will or trust, or needing help with Medicaid planning
  • Dealing with guardianship or power of attorney issues for an elderly family member
  • Facing disputes over elder care, including addressing elder abuse or neglect or navigating long-term care options

What Could Happen if I Don’t Hire an Elder Law Lawyer?

If you don’t hire an elder law lawyer, you might face difficulties managing legal and financial issues for yourself or an elderly loved one. Without proper guidance, you could make mistakes in estate planning, leading to family disputes or financial losses. You might struggle to navigate complex Medicaid rules or face challenges securing appropriate care. In cases of elder abuse or neglect, you may not know how to protect your loved one’s rights. A lawyer helps you address these issues effectively, ensuring your loved one’s well-being and securing their financial future.

What Questions Should I Ask When Trying To Find an Elder Law Lawyer in Rossmoor?

These questions can help you decide if you feel comfortable and confident that a lawyer has the qualifications, experience, and ability to manage your case well. Many lawyers offer free consultations that allow you to understand your options and get specific legal advice before hiring them. The top questions to ask include:

  • How have you handled cases like mine?
  • What are the potential outcomes of my case?
  • What is the timeline for my case?
  • Are there alternative dispute resolutions available, like mediation or arbitration?
  • What is your billing and fee structure?
  • How long have you been practicing in California?
  • Do you have access to experts who can support my case?
  • How do you approach evidence collection?
  • What is your approach to negotiations and settlements?
  • What will my involvement be during the process?
